The global business travel market size was valued at USD 695.9 billion in 2020 and is expected to reach USD 2,001.1 billion by 2028, growing at a CAGR of 13.2% from 2021-2028.

BUSINESS TRAVEL MARKET SHARE ANALYSIS

The food and lodging category is anticipated to increase at a CAGR of 14.2% during the forecast period, making it the fastest-growing area based on service in the business travel market.

According to the research on the business travel market by industry, the corporate sector dominated the market and is anticipated to develop at the quickest rate because of the expansion of business activities throughout the world. The corporate sector, which held 65.6% of the market in 2020, is anticipated to grow at the highest CAGR of 14.1% throughout the course of the forecast period.

Travelers were the largest and fastest-growing sector, accounting for 59.5% of the market in 2020 and projected to expand at a substantial CAGR of 14.3% in the years to come. The group market is thriving because group travel has cheaper costs. The service providers also provide group travel discounts on lodging and transportation.

As a result of its quickly expanding infrastructure, conducive business environment, and government initiatives to draw in foreign investment, the Asia-Pacific area is the world's largest and fastest-growing market for business travel.
